Product

MicroAire K-Wires

Reason

Mislabeling on three lots of K-Wires. The incorrect product description " dual trocar" instead of "single trocar" was on the product label on the following parts: 1600-9355NS (lot 61005), 1600-9625NS (lot 60297), and 1604-162NS (lot 62856).

Identifiers

code_infoPart Number, Lot Number, Quantity Distributed to Field 1600-9355NS, 61005, 56; 1600-9625NS, 60297, 209; 1604-162NS, 62856, 97.
